What are a shipping company’s main criteria when selecting a ship-
yard for repairs or newbuildings?
The decisive factor in choosing the area where a ship
will be repaired is the trading route. The parameters
considered during the final selection of a repair yard
are the yard’s capabilities, references from previous
repairs, cost, payment terms, and repair period. For
newbuildings, the criteria are different. In terms of ship
value and quality, the country where the shipyard is
located is critical. Developing a newbuilding design is
a time-consuming and costly process. Each shipyard
focuses on building specific types and sizes of ships
according to its experience, know-how, and capabilities.
When choosing a shipyard to construct a new building,
the main factors are ship specifications, cost, financing,
and delivery time.
How often do you consider repositioning ships because of their
special repair requirements or the fact that there are no reliable
repair facilities/options in the area they trade?
Drydockings are planned well in advance in coordina-
tion with the chartering department to avoid the cost of
deviation from the last port of discharge and minimise
the off-hire time. The last voyage of the ship is not
booked based only on the best commercial offer but
also by considering the best position and conditions
for the vessel to call at a repair yard.
